Main navigation
- Programs
- Subjects
- Universities
- Destinations
- Advice
This two-year Computer Programming Diploma from Ontario College equips students for careers in software development, with a focus on object-oriented modeling, database design, and administration.
Students work with industry-standard tools like Oracle and CASE tools while mastering programming languages including Java, JavaScript, COBOL, SQL, and PHP. The curriculum covers object-oriented analysis, operating systems, and integrated development environments, teaching essential skills for debugging, testing, and code maintenance.
During their final term, students engage in a practical software development project with external clients, gaining valuable industry experience.
The program offers an optional paid co-op opportunity for hands-on learning (see Additional Information). Availability of co-op positions depends on both academic performance and program capacity. Admission to the co-op stream doesn't ensure placement.